Joseph "Dub" William Merryman, 88, of Chouteau, passed away on Wednesday, September 1, 2021 in Catoosa, Oklahoma. He was born on September 25, 1932 in Salina, Oklahoma; the son of Arthur Merryman and Cecil (McElvey) Merryman. Dub worked for many years as a pipefitter, and joined the Pipefitters Union #205 in 1965, and retired on September 25, 1994. He attended Victory Tabernacle Church in Claremore. Dub looked forward to spending time outdoors, especially when he was able to go fishing, hunting, gardening, work cattle, antiquing and traveling. He also had a special love for blackberry cobbler and strawberry ice cream. Dub was a wonderful father, brother, grandfather, great grandfather and friend and leaves behind many memories for his family to cherish.

Dub is survived by his sons, Gary Merryman and wife Mary of Terlton, Oklahoma and Freddie Potter and wife Wynema of Chouteau, Oklahoma; daughters, Linda Smithee and husband Don of Cleveland, Oklahoma and Sherril George and husband Benny of Inola, Oklahoma; brother, Vic Merryman and wife Carolyn of Inola, Oklahoma; sister, Wanda Hall of Tulsa, Oklahoma; 10 grandchildren; 24 great grandchildren; and 7 great great grandchildren; and many other relatives and friends. He is preceded in death by his wife, Cleo Merryman; parents, Arthur and Cecil Merryman; grandson, Daniel Potter; great grandson, Timothy George; brothers, Roland Merryman and Denver Merryman; and sisters, Shirley Desoto and Nevada Kirby.
